HH Sheikh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um, Vice President and Prime Minister of the UAE and Ruler of Dubai, has ordered a third shipment of emergency humanitarian aid to the affected areas of the Hashemite Kingdom of Jordan in order to help those affected by the floods. Their suffering.

"With direct guidance from Mohammed bin Rashid, we will continue to oversee efforts to help families and families affected by the floods," said His Highness Princess Haya Bint Al Hussein, President of the Board of Directors of the International Humanitarian City in Dubai. , And to provide all possible assistance to relieve them, including follow-up of the process of shipment of relief materials and confirm their arrival as soon as possible. This is the third shipment of emergency aid ordered by HH Sheikh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um, Vice President and Prime Minister of the UAE and Ruler of Dubai, in less than 48 hours. The second shipment of relief items, including 85 tons of Basic necessities for subsistence on a Boeing 747, with the contribution of the UAE Red Crescent.
